Simplified Aid for Extra-Vehicular Activity Rescue (SAFER) Battery Assessment

Abstract: In 2013, the Boeing Company model 787-8 Dreamliner commercial aircraft experienced three catastrophic lithium (Li) battery failures. The cause of each failure resulted in a single-cell thermal runaway (TR) condition, which propagated to adjacent battery cells. Two of the failures involved rechargeable lithium-ion (Li-Ion) batteries, and the third event involved a nonrechargeable lithium-manganese dioxide (Li-MnO2) battery.
